I've been doing this chicken thing for a little over two years now. Five of my hens were dropping their eggs where they were supposed to, and putting themselves up at night... Yes, everything was just fine until a few months ago, around the start of summer. I introduced a rooster, and they all lost their minds for some reason. I saw less and less eggs, and more free ranging. They were going to bed very late! Sometimes I would catch them roaming the yard as late as 9:00! It wasn't long before I had to start buying grocery store eggs. They stopped putting themselves up at night, and insisted on venturing into the woods to do their laying in private!

I've asked for advice on this before, and I've certainly followed it as best I can but with very poor results. I've tried the fake eggs, I've tried making their nests darker, elevating them more, lowering them, locking them up... I can't take it anymore! My girls lay late in the morning, so I can no longer keep them penned up until they lay, as I have to leave earlier than that every morning and don't get home until 2:00 or 3:00.

How can I get them to stay in their coop until they lay their eggs, without me having to lock them up all day? Last time I tried that, they got really angry at me and went on egg strike for a whole month! Please help me!
